Multiple Pareto index regression with application to large claim costs

Résumé

In insurance and reinsurance, an important interest is modeling extreme claim costs. For this motivation, Pareto distributions have been successfully applied in extreme value analysis. Under a single-parameter Pareto distribution of a response variable, we propose a new approach to estimate the Pareto index. We assume that the Pareto index is an unspecified function that depends on multiple indices induced by covariates, which constitutes ’a single-parameter Pareto index regression in multiple-index model’. We obtain the parameter estimators by using an approximate maximum likelihood estimation (aMLE) method where the likelihood function for the Exponential distribution approximates the corresponding function of the Pareto distribution through the log-transformation of the response variable. The number of indices is determined by a cross-validation technique. We show our approach by a simulation argument and its application to claim cost data, and discuss its practical performance.
